Took a little trip up to Club de Tier in Montreal on Tuesday past. Terry and Frank are good guys. Got a chance to hold a new CZ SP-01 and can confirm the comments here on how well it fits to hand. I didn't get a chance to shoot it, but it was the most comfortable to hold of 8 or 10 that I tried on for size (heaviest too).

I did get to shoot 50 rounds through each of a Glock 17 (9mm), H&K USP in .40, and a Norinco 1911 in .45 (in that order) at their indoor range. The H&K was sweet.

It was my wife's firt time shooting a pistol, and she shot a half dozen rounds out of each. Her first shot with the H&K was dead on the X (25 ft). I never got an X all day.

She held my new Beretta ES100 Pintail shotgun last night and all she said was 'it's light'. I think I am creating a 5'4", 130 lb. monster.

I am about to buy a CZ SP-01.
